The Children’s Chorus of Russia, featuring a thousand children from all of the country’s regions, and the Mariinsky Orchestra under the baton of Valery Gergiev have released their first recording – the song Music of the Sun. The soloist is Timur Slanov and the recording was produced in January 2014 in the acoustically perfect surroundings of the Concert Hall of the Mariinsky Theatre
